Fees and Cost Over Time
IVV charges 0.03% per year while WDE charges 0.19%. On a $10,000 position that is $3 vs $19 annually, a gap of $16 per year that compounds over a long holding period. On income, IVV currently yields 1.10% against 0.40% for WDE.
